Cap is an immutable class used to define the style of the start and end points of a Polyline on a map.
It offers various subclasses like ButtCap, RoundCap, SquareCap, and CustomCap for different cap styles.
Cap inherits from Object and implements Parcelable, providing methods like equals, hashCode, and toString.
Developers can customize the appearance of Polyline endpoints using the different Cap types available.
Known Direct Subclasses
ButtCap
Cap that is squared off exactly at the start or end vertex of a Polyline with solid
stroke pattern, equivalent to having no additional cap beyond the start or end vertex.
CustomCap
Bitmap overlay centered at the start or end vertex of a Polyline , orientated according to
the direction of the line's first or last edge and scaled with respect to the line's stroke
width.
RoundCap
Cap that is a semicircle with radius equal to half the stroke width, centered at the start or end
vertex of a Polyline with solid stroke pattern.
SquareCap
Cap that is squared off after extending half the stroke width beyond the start or end vertex of a
Polyline with solid stroke pattern.
Immutable cap that can be applied at the start or end vertex of a Polyline .
